The answer can be fairly complicated.
* We can only recommend selling prices, it's illegal for us to try and control what other people re-sell our product for.
* The US market is different to Aus, the wholesalers tend to sell direct more so there are fewer middle men, and there is a lot more online sellers who have less overheads.
* The value of the AU$ has a big effect as you already mentioned.
* Their market is 50 times bigger than ours, so they are more able to buy in bulk to get a cheaper price.
* There also seems to be a lot more product exchanges over there which can de-value some items.
* The after sales service won't be as good buying from an OS supplier.

We still support the product but any issues have to be dealt with thru the channell they were sourced. Fortunately we don't have too many issues.
The offset LS rockers are a little higher in price to the straight ones and the first batch supplied to the US was sold incorrectly (by our own warehouse) at the LS1 price so I think the landed price would be a lot closer now, particularly with recent changes to the Aussie dollar.
As a customer I suppose it's just a matter of timing as to getting the best value and service so it pays to shop around sometimes.
